The development of a CXCR2 chemokine receptorbinding assay using the LEADseeker Multimodality Imaging System

br> Results
Kd determination
Saturation binding was performed with dilutions of [125I]GRO-αto give a range of concentrations from 2.5 to 2000 pM in the wells. Figure 1 shows the saturation curve that was fitted using non-linear regression with the data analysis software package GraphPad Prism v4.0. A Kd value of 383 pM (95% confidence intervals 318 to 447 pM) was estimated directly from the curve and Bmax was determined at 6 pmol/mg of protein.

DMSO tolerance
Dilutions of DMSO were prepared in assay buffer to give a range of concentrations from 2% (v/v) to 25% (v/v) in the wells. From the results shown in figure 2 it can be seen that the assay was tolerant to DMSO up to a final concentration of 12.5% (v/v)

IC50 determination
Competitive binding of 0.37-nM [125I]GRO-αwith unlabeled IL-8 and GRO-αwas assessed and the IC50 values calculated as shown in Figure 3. DMSO was included at an assay concentration of 2.5% (v/v). Final concentrations in the well for unlabeled GRO-αwere 0.03 to 440 nM, and for unlabeled IL-8, 0.03 to 500 nM.

The IC50 value for GRO-αwas determined to be 2 nM (95% confidence interval range 1.7 to 2.3 nM) and the Ki value was 1.02 nM (95% confidence intervals 0.87 to 1.19 nM). The IC50 value for IL-8 was 11 nM (95% confidence interval range 10 to 12 nM) and the Ki was 5.68 nM (95% confidence intervals 5.14 to 6.27 nM).
